Job description
A renowned UK studio with a global reach, known for their award-winning work across commercial, residential, mixed use and education schemes, are looking for a Senior Interior Designer to join their London studio.
About this role
This multi award-winning studio is looking for a Senior Interior Designer to work across a range of their projects from early-stage interior concepts through to technical delivery within budget and on time. You will work closely with one of the Partners and you will have the opportunity to liaise directly with clients, lead projects and help train and develop more junior staff.
About you
- You will have good knowledge of AutoCAD, Revit or SketchUp
- You will have experience working on a range of project typologies. Experience with working on commercial, residential, mixed use and education schemes is preferred.
- You will have experience in developing early-stage interior concepts and strategies through to delivering drawing and specification packages
- You will have experience leading a team and mentoring others
- You will have experience managing and working with different clients, project types and scales
- You will have experience working collaboratively with architectural and external consultants
- You will have worked at a leading architecture practice in a similar role
What's on offer
This is an incredible opportunity to join one of the best studio’s in the UK and be part of a growing team of talented architects and designers. They are known for supporting their staff in their career aspirations and for having some of the best benefits in the industry including private medical insurance, a yearly bonus, flexible working with some days in office and the rest working remotely and a generous annual leave allowance.
